Technical Problem

The nozzles of existing medicinal herb cleaning devices have a small coverage area and the angle cannot be adjusted, resulting in incomplete cleaning of medicinal herbs, which affects the purity and efficacy of the herbs.

Method used

A rotary pressure spray head washing device was designed. The motor drives the rotating shaft to rotate the washing disc. The spray head angle is adjusted by a telescopic rod and gear transmission system. Water is recycled through a water supply mechanism to ensure comprehensive cleaning of medicinal materials and water conservation.

Benefits of technology

It achieves comprehensive and efficient cleaning of medicinal materials, ensures a clean cleaning environment, saves water resources, and improves the cleaning quality and efficiency of medicinal materials.

Abstract

The utility model relates to the technical field of medicine production, and discloses a rotary type pressure nozzle medicine washing device which comprises a workbench, a working groove is formed in the top of the workbench, a motor is fixedly connected to the bottom of the working groove, and the output end of the motor penetrates through the working groove and is fixedly connected with a rotating shaft. A medicine washing tray is fixedly connected to the top end of the rotating shaft, a plurality of water leakage holes are fixedly formed in the bottom of the medicine washing tray at equal intervals, a support is fixedly connected to the top of the workbench, telescopic rods are fixedly connected to the left side and the right side of the bottom of the support, and transverse plates are fixedly connected to the bottom ends of the two telescopic rods; and the bottom of the transverse plate is fixedly connected with a circular ring. According to the medicine washing device, the motor drives the medicine washing disc to rotate, water is drained in time through the water leakage holes, the first rotating rod is rotated to drive the driving gear to operate, the second rotating rod and the spray head are rotated through transmission of the driven gear, the angle is adjusted, and medicine in the medicine washing disc is washed in an all-dimensional and efficient mode.

TECHNICAL FIELD

[0001] The utility model relates to the technical field of medicine production, especially relates to a rotary pressure spray head medicine washing device. BACKGROUND

[0002] In the medicinal material processing, it is very necessary to use the medicine washing device, first, the medicinal material will be contaminated with a large amount of silt, dust, microorganism and residual pesticide in the collection, transportation and storage process, if not washing, the impurities will seriously affect the quality and medicinal effect of medicinal material, second, the artificial cleaning can not guarantee the consistency and thoroughness of cleaning, and the efficiency is low and a large amount of manpower cost is consumed, and the medicine washing device can remove various dirt on the surface of medicinal material through mechanical movement and specific cleaning process, ensure that the medicinal material reaches the specified cleaning standard, lay a good foundation for subsequent processing and processing, thereby improve the quality and efficiency of the whole medicinal material processing link.

[0003] Through the search, the patent of China patent publication number is: CN203621009U, the utility model discloses a medicinal material cleaning device, including water tank, the bottom of water tank is connected with water outlet pipe, water outlet pipe is connected with water pump, and water pump is connected with the water pipe and sprays, and the spray is provided with two, and two sprays are horizontally arranged and transversely spaced, and the spray is below and is equipped with the transversely arranged medicinal material cleaning channel, and the medicinal material cleaning channel is connected with the drain pipe, the water tank of the utility model is used to store clean water, and the water is sprayed from the spray after being pressurized by the water pump, the medicinal material cleaning channel is used to place medicinal material, and the water sprayed in the spray flushes the medicinal material placed on the medicinal material cleaning channel, and the medicinal material is flushed clean, and then the medicinal material is recycled, which is convenient and fast, improves the working efficiency, and since the water sprayed by the spray has pressure, the medicinal material is cleaned more cleanly, but in the actual use, the coverage of two sprays is small and the angle cannot be adjusted, and the medicinal material cannot be cleaned in all directions, and the remaining silt and dust can affect the purity of medicinal material and reduce its medicinal effect. UTILITY MODEL CONTENTS

[0004] In order to make up for the above shortcomings, the utility model provides a rotary pressure spray head medicine washing device, which aims at improving the problem that the coverage of two sprays in the prior art is small and the angle cannot be adjusted, and the medicinal material cannot be cleaned in all directions.

[0008] The water supply mechanism comprises a water storage tank, the right side of the water storage tank is fixedly connected to the left side of the workbench, the top of the water storage tank is fixedly connected with a water pump, the right side of the water pump is communicated with a water delivery pipe, the other end of the water delivery pipe penetrates through the support and is communicated with the corresponding spray head, the inner bottom of the work tank is provided with a drain port, the front side of the workbench is provided with a water collecting tank, the top of the water collecting tank is communicated with the drain port, the front side of the water collecting tank is slidably connected with a water collecting tank, the front side of the water storage tank is fixedly connected with a filter tank, the front side of the filter tank is fixedly connected with a water valve, the front end of the water valve is communicated with a recovery pipe, the other end of the recovery pipe penetrates through the workbench and is communicated with the left side of the water collecting tank.

[0009] Through the above technical scheme: when the water pump is started, the water in the water storage tank is pumped out, the water is delivered through the water delivery pipe, the water delivery pipe is communicated with each spray head after penetrating through the support, so as to supply water to the spray head. During the process of washing medicine, the sewage flows into the work tank through the water leakage hole at the bottom of the medicine washing disc, the drain port at the inner bottom of the work tank guides the sewage to the water collecting tank, and the water collecting tank slidably connected with the front side of the water collecting tank is used for collecting the sewage. When the sewage in the water collecting tank reaches a certain amount, it can be pumped out for treatment. The sewage in the water tank can flow into the filter tank through the recovery pipe after opening the water valve for filtration. The filtered water can flow into the water storage tank again and be pumped out by the water pump for spraying the spray head to clean it. To some extent, water resources are saved and the utilization rate of water is improved.

[0045] Working principle: in the use of rotary pressure spray head wash medicine device, need first to be placed in the wash medicine tray 6, at this time start motor 4 drive rotating shaft 5 rotation, rotating shaft 5 top fixed wash medicine tray 6 with rotation, wash medicine tray 6 bottom equidistantly opened multiple drain holes 7, can let the sewage in the cleaning process in time discharge, ensure the clean of wash medicine environment and avoid sewage soak medicine, the support 8 of workbench 1 top plays the supporting role, its bottom left and right sides telescopic rod 9 can adjust height, by adjusting the length of telescopic rod 9, can change the height position of cross plate 10 and the lower connecting component, to adapt to the wash medicine demand of different height, the circular ring 11 of cross plate 10 bottom connects multiple fixed frame 12, the rotating rod one 13 one end penetrates fixed frame 12 and fixedly connected driving gear 14, when rotating rotating rod one 13, driving gear 14 rotates with it, the rotating rod two 15 of fixed frame 12 bottom rotation connection, its outer wall right side driven gear 16 is meshed with driving gear 14, the rotation of driving gear 14 drives driven gear 16 to rotate, in turn makes rotating rod two 15 rotate, the fixed nozzle 17 of rotating rod two 15 outer wall left side will be rotated under the drive of rotating rod two 15, adjust the angle of nozzle 17, at the same time, the water flow from nozzle 17 can be sprayed to the medicine in wash medicine tray 6, and when water pump 202 starts, the water in storage tank 201 is pumped out, the water is transported through water delivery pipe 203, water delivery pipe 203 passes through support 8 and communicates with each nozzle 17, so as to supply water to nozzle 17, in the process of washing medicine, the sewage flows into working tank 3 through the drain hole 7 at the bottom of the wash medicine tray 6, the drain 204 at the bottom of the inner side of the working tank 3 guides the sewage to the water collecting tank 205, the water collecting tank 206 slidingly connected to the front side of the water collecting tank 205 is used for collecting sewage, when the sewage in the water collecting tank 206 reaches a certain amount, it can be pumped out for treatment, the sewage in the water collecting tank 206 can flow into the filter box 207 through the opening of the water valve 208 and the recovery pipe 209 for filtration, the water filtered by the filter box 207 can flow into the storage tank 201 again and be pumped out by the water pump 202 for spraying by the nozzle 17, which saves water resources to some extent and improves the utilization rate of water.
